This can be what precisely the attention does when looking via a magnifying glass. The magnifying glass creates a (magnified) virtual graphic behind the magnifying glass, but These rays are then re-imaged because of the lens of the attention to create a actual graphic over the retina.

contact lenses — lenses worn right from the attention, divided from it only by a film of tear fluid. Corneal microlenses cover just the cornea, even though haptic lenses protect a number of the encompassing sclera in addition.
